- Carrara abstract "Carrara [karˈraːra] (Emilian: Carara) is a city and comune in the Province of Massa and Carrara (Tuscany, Italy), notable for the white or blue-grey marble quarried there. It is on the Carrione River, some 100 kilometres (62 mi) west-northwest of Florence.Its motto is Fortitudo mea in rota (Latin: \"My strength is in the wheel\").".
